I have 1 store bought one ( A Ameristep "Dog House" )
very easy to wheel my chair in and plenty of room inside. This blind is compact and folds up to about a 22" circle making it easy to move from place to place its 60"x60" with a ceiling of 68" once its opened with 4 shooting windows. Others I have are shipping crates a buddy of mine gets from where he works, they are 4'x4'x5'tall. I take and open 1 complete side to where I can get my wheelchair in, then cut 3 14"x24"long shooting windows in it on the 3 remaining sides. Paint army drab and im done. These are not as roomy as the Ameristep blind but work just fine. I also cover the Top with tin over the roof . Makes a dry blind. |
